Plot
Fei is a young homosexual who works as a prostitute, a victim of a homophobic and repressive society that generates a great feeling of guilt. Although his family accepts the money he brings home, he does not approve of his lifestyle or his sexual orientation. His world collapses before the intolerance that exists in his house, so he decides to start a new life away from his family. Moneyboys is the portrait of the life of a young man who emigrates from the countryside to find life in the big city. Xaolai, a kind of mentor, instructs him in the world of prostitution, until Fei manages to gain some experience in the trade. Over time, he is reunited with a love from his youth that will make him reconsider many things. In the words of the director and screenwriter himself,
C.B. Yi, "Moneyboys may be about a very specific situation, a young man's migration from rural China, but to me it's a universal story about interpersonal relationships that could happen in many places around the world." Through this film, the Chinese director makes a tremendous criticism of the precarious situation faced by many young people who are pushed to engage in sexual practices against their will. It is also a criticism of a hypocritical society.
The film is starred by Kai Ko, Yufan Bai and Chloe Maayan.
